Topics to be covered:
- Symplectic and Kähler structures;
- Hermitian structures;
- Almost-complex structures and integrability;
- Obstructions to the existence of an almost-complex structure;
- Cohomology of almost-complex manifolds;
- Courant bracket and Dirac structures;
- Generalized complex structures;
- Submanifolds of generalized complex structures;
- Generalized Kähler structures.
Bibliography:
- R. Bryant, On the geometry of almost-complex manifolds. Asian J. Math. 10 (2006), 561 - 605;
- M. Gualtieri, Generalized complex geometry. arXiv:math/0401221, January 2004;
- M. Gualtieri, Generalized complex geometry. Ann. of Math. 2 (2011), 75--123;
- N. Hitchin, Generalized Calabi-Yau manifolds, Q. J. Math. 54 (2003), 281 -308;
- N. Hitchin, Lectures on generalized geometry. arXiv:math.DG:1008.0973, August 2010.
